What are the responsibilities and job description for the Quality Assurance Team Lead position at MONTEREY BAY HERB CO.?
Overview
The QA Technician Team Lead plays a key leadership role within the Quality Assurance department, supporting day-to-day food safety operations while providing guidance and oversight to the QA Technician team. Reporting to the FSQA Manager, this position serves as the go-to lead for floor-level QA execution, documentation accuracy, cross-departmental coordination, and technician training. The ideal candidate is an experienced QA professional with a strong foundation in food safety, hands-on inspection practices, and a proactive mindset for continuous improvement and team support.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ead daily QA technician activities, including shift task delegation, inspection schedules, and verification of critical control points.
- Conduct inspections of raw materials, in-process items, and finished products, ensuring compliance with specifications and food safety standards.
- Support implementation and monitoring of HACCP and GMP programs; act as floor-level HACCP verifier.
- Perform QA checks such as metal detection, weight verification, label reviews, and visual inspections.
- Review and approve QA documentation, including batch records, hold logs, and sanitation verifications for accuracy and completeness.
- Assist with QA training and onboarding of new technicians; provide ongoing coaching and feedback to improve performance.
- Serve as the QA point-of-contact on the floor during audits, production runs, or quality deviations when the manager is unavailable.
- Participate in root cause analysis and corrective action processes related to quality and food safety issues.
- Communicate quality concerns promptly and clearly to the FSQA Manager and support resolution efforts.
- Assist with internal audits, mock recalls, traceability exercises, and vendor documentation reviews.
- Monitor daily QA KPIs and help identify trends or opportunities for operational improvement.
Required Qualifications
- High school diploma or equivalent required; associate or bachelor’s degree in Food Science, Biology, or related field preferred
- 3–5 years of QA experience in a food manufacturing or botanical/dietary ingredient environment
- Prior leadership or team lead experience strongly preferred
- Working knowledge of HACCP, GMPs, FSMA, and 21 CFR 111/117 regulations
- Familiarity with Organic, Kosher, and SQF certification requirements
- Competency with sampling, inspections, documentation review, and deviation management
- Experience with data entry, traceability, and QA recordkeeping systems
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and SharePoint platforms
- Bilingual in English and Spanish (required)
Certifications (Preferred)
- HACCP Certificate
- PCQI Certificate
- SQF Practitioner (in progress or experienced with SQF audits)
